Louise

Date of birth: 
7/1840* (estimated)
Date of death: 
1848* (estimated)
Baptism Date and Sponsors: 
March 28, 1841; Sponsors: Jacques Roman and Louise Roman
Place of Origin: 
Oak Alley (Creole)
Gender and Designation: 
Female (Negro)
Relationships: 
Mother: Sarah; Sibling: Charlotte
Notes: 
*Died before 1848 inventory under Jacques Telesphore Roman's succession.
References: 
  • Slave baptism records, Archdiocese of Baton Rouge
    • St. Michael Catholic Church, Convent, Louisiana
    • Item no. 9; Page no. 18; Entry no. 9
    • Lists Sarah as Louise's mother
  • R8.198
    • Jacques Telesphore Roman Succession, St. James Clerk of Court, Probate 0683
    • Lists Sarah as Charlotte's mother; Estimated that Louise and Charlotte are siblings

 

* Denotes estimated date based on available records.
